Valentine's Day should be avoided: Pakistan President tells countrymen
Islamabad, Feb 13 (IBNS); Pakistan President Mamnoon Hussain has urged people not to celebrate Valentine’s Day.
He said observing the day is not a part of the Muslim tradition.
Speaking at a function to pay tribute to Pakistan Movement leader Sardar Abdur Rab Nishtar on his death anniversary, Hussain was quoted as saying by Dawn News: "Valentine’s Day has no connection with our culture and it should be avoided.”
Valentine’s Day will be celebrated across the globe on Sunday.
